These days, finding an affordable place to live in the Norfolk area can be challenging. Home prices in Norfolk are now at a median cost of $103,361, lower than the New York average of $481,023.
The average cost of rent is $682/mo in Norfolk, primarily driven by the current value of real estate in the Norfolk area. While nearly 45.74% of residents own their homes outright in Norfolk, 25.66% rent.
Housing affordability isn’t just about home prices, though. The average household income in Norfolk is $4,552 per month. Households that rent pay about 14.98% of their income on rent here. Norfolk's most expensive areas are in the northeastern regions, while the cheapest areas are in the northwestern parts of the city.
